This week’s Baker Hughes rig count shows that U.S. had a decrease of 2 over last week, resulting in a total count of 251 rigs. Canada had an increase of 10 over last week, resulting in a total Canadian count of 42 rigs.

Breakdown by region
Of the regions tracked by Baker Hughes, three regions, the Eagle Ford, Granite Wash and the Permian saw an increase this week.
Meanwhile, 2 regions experienced a decrease this week:
- The Cana Woodford is at 5, down 1 from last week.
- The Marcellus is at 25, down 2 from last week.
